Lines Matching defs:isValueAvailable
187 bool isValueAvailable(const Value *V) const;
1025 bool AArch64FastISel::isValueAvailable(const Value *V) const {
1196 if (UseAdd && LHS->hasOneUse() && isValueAvailable(LHS))
1201 if (UseAdd && LHS->hasOneUse() && isValueAvailable(LHS))
1234 isValueAvailable(RHS)) {
1243 if (RHS->hasOneUse() && isValueAvailable(RHS)) {
1265 if (RHS->hasOneUse() && isValueAvailable(RHS)) {
1589 if (LHS->hasOneUse() && isValueAvailable(LHS))
1594 if (LHS->hasOneUse() && isValueAvailable(LHS))
1612 if (RHS->hasOneUse() && isValueAvailable(RHS)) {
1634 if (RHS->hasOneUse() && isValueAvailable(RHS)) {
2305 if (AI->getOpcode() == Instruction::And && isValueAvailable(AI)) {
2396 if (CI->hasOneUse() && isValueAvailable(CI)) {
2720 isValueAvailable(Cond)) {
3418 if (!isValueAvailable(II))
4677 if (isValueAvailable(ZExt) && isTypeSupported(ZExt->getSrcTy(), VT)) {
4686 if (isValueAvailable(SExt) && isTypeSupported(SExt->getSrcTy(), VT)) {
4741 if (isValueAvailable(ZExt) && isTypeSupported(ZExt->getSrcTy(), TmpVT)) {
4750 if (isValueAvailable(SExt) && isTypeSupported(SExt->getSrcTy(), TmpVT)) {